Football Preview: Elizabeth Cardinals vs. Brush Beetdiggers
Two dominant backs in Tristan McCray and Ritchie Bruno are getting ready to go toe-to-toe. The Elizabeth Cardinals will host the Brush Beetdiggers at 1:00 p.m. on Saturday. Both teams are coming into the matchup red-hot, with Elizabeth sitting on four straight wins and Brush on ten.
Elizabeth is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Saturday. They secured a 44-38 W over Pagosa Springs.

Griffin Widhalm was nothing short of spectacular: he rushed for 119 yards and one touchdown on only 12 carries. Andrew Martinez was in the mix too, providing Elizabeth with two scores.
They were just one part of a punishing run game: Elizabeth was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 283 rushing yards.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now rushed for at least 166 rushing yards in seven consecutive games.
Meanwhile, Brush got the win against Delta on Saturday by a conclusive 28-7. Considering the Beetdiggers have won seven contests by more than 20 points this season, Saturday's blowout was nothing new.
Elizabeth's record now sits at 8-2. As for Brush, their record is now 10-0.
